Clinical Nurse - Adult Community Mental Health - Salisbury - 5 day roster Northern Adelaide Local Health Network – Salisbury SA Northern Adelaide Local Health Network – Northern Community Mental Health – Salisbury Salary - $87,416 - $110,497 p.a. plus Superannuation and Salary Sacrifice benefits -RN2C - Ongoing About the Role Join SA Health's Northern Adelaide Local Health Network as a Clinical Nurse in our Adult Community Mental Health team at Salisbury. This full-time permanent position offers a structured 5-day roster, providing excellent work-life balance while delivering essential mental health services to our community.What You'll Do: Provide comprehensive clinical nursing care to adults experiencing mental health challenges in community settings Conduct assessments, develop care plans, and deliver evidence-based interventions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ams including psychiatrists, psychologists, and social workers Support clients and families through recovery-focused care approaches Participate in case management and community outreach programs To be eligible for this position, you must be registered as a Nurse by the Nursing/Midwifery Board of Australia (NMBA) and hold a current practising certificate. You must be enrolled in an approved mental health course or hold a qualification in mental health practice. About Us The Northern Adelaide Local Health Network (NALHN) serves over 400,000 people in northern Adelaide with a comprehensive range of high-quality medical services, including emergency, surgical, obstetric, neonatal, paediatric, oncology, geriatric, palliative care and rehabilitation, and mental health care. Recently, NALHN has upgraded its facilities and plans to expand further. The network provides primary health care with a focus on community health promotion and chronic disease management. With nearly 6,500 employees, NALHN emphasises quality care and a supportive work environment guided by respect, integrity, and accountability.
